The Park is strategically located in the center of what is known as the Colombian Massif watershed, the most important watershed in the country. Three of the most important rivers of Colombia originate there, the Magdalena, Cauca and Caquetá rivers; the Quilcacé and Guachinoco rivers also originate in the Park, which are the main tributaries of the Patía river. El Buey, San Rafael and La Magdalena lagoons are the most impressive among the 30 lagoons in the Park.
